ChatGPT - Unfold AI Capabilities
Monitors changes made by AI agents (Cursor, Copilot, Claude Code, Codex, Continue, Codeium) in real-time and generates issue cards when operations fail, using terminal output analysis, VS Code Problems panel monitoring, and dependency tracking to identify divergence between expected and actual repository state before user commits.
Unique: Adds a supervision layer specifically for AI agents by monitoring terminal output, Problems panel, and file changes simultaneously to detect failures before commit — most code editors lack this multi-signal failure detection for agent-generated code.
vs alternatives: Unlike native Copilot or Claude Code error handling, Unfold AI provides cross-agent failure detection and pre-commit review gates, catching issues from any supported agent in a unified interface.
Captures automatic checkpoints around meaningful work during AI-assisted coding sessions and enables comparison between current state, previous checkpoints, and checkpoint-to-checkpoint diffs. On Pro/Ultra plans, generates AI-powered semantic titles for older checkpoints to make session history navigable without manual annotation.
Unique: Combines automatic checkpoint capture with AI-generated semantic titles (Pro/Ultra) to make session history navigable by meaning rather than timestamp — most editors only offer git history or manual save points, not AI-annotated session checkpoints.
vs alternatives: Provides finer-grained session history than git commits (captures intermediate agent work) and adds semantic understanding via AI titles, whereas VS Code's native undo/redo lacks agent-aware context and Cursor's built-in history lacks cross-session comparison.
Generates natural language commit messages for agent-assisted changes by analyzing the full session context (checkpoints, changes, failures, root causes, fixes applied). Commit summaries are grounded in actual session evidence rather than generic templates, providing meaningful context for future code review and history.
Unique: Generates commit messages grounded in full session evidence (failures, fixes, root causes) rather than just file diffs — most git tools generate messages from diffs alone without semantic context.
vs alternatives: Unlike conventional commit tools or AI-powered commit message generators, Unfold AI includes session-specific context (failures, recovery steps, root causes) in commit messages, making them more informative for future reviewers.
Analyzes all changes made during an AI-assisted session and generates pre-commit risk signals by tracking which agent made which changes, identifying high-risk patterns (dependency modifications, API changes, security-sensitive code), and attributing changes to specific agents or user actions. Provides structured change summaries grounded in actual session evidence.
Unique: Generates pre-commit risk signals by analyzing agent-specific change patterns and dependency modifications in real-time, with attribution tracking — most code editors lack agent-aware risk assessment and change attribution.
vs alternatives: Unlike generic pre-commit hooks or linters, Unfold AI understands which AI agent made which change and flags agent-specific risk patterns (e.g., incomplete refactors by Copilot), providing context-aware risk signals rather than syntax-only checks.
When an agent operation fails, analyzes session context (terminal output, file changes, Problems panel diagnostics, dependency state) and generates an AI-powered explanation of the likely root cause. Uses session timeline reconstruction to correlate failures with specific agent actions and provide actionable context for recovery.
Unique: Generates AI-powered root cause explanations by correlating terminal output, file changes, and session timeline — most debugging tools show raw errors; Unfold AI adds semantic analysis of why the agent's action failed.
vs alternatives: Unlike VS Code's native error messages or agent-specific error handling, Unfold AI provides cross-agent root cause analysis grounded in session context, making it faster to diagnose failures from any supported agent.
Generates a proposed fix plan for detected failures, claiming to identify the 'smallest safe fix' needed to recover from the failure. On Pro/Ultra plans, provides auto-apply capability to automatically apply the fix plan to the codebase; on Free plan, presents fix plan as a suggestion for manual review and application.
Unique: Generates agent-specific fix plans by analyzing failure context and proposes 'smallest safe fix' — most agents lack built-in failure recovery; Unfold AI adds automated fix proposal and optional auto-apply for Pro/Ultra users.
vs alternatives: Unlike Copilot or Claude Code's error handling (which requires manual user fixes), Unfold AI proposes specific fixes and can auto-apply them on Pro/Ultra plans, reducing manual debugging overhead.
Provides an interactive chat interface within VS Code that is pre-loaded with full session context (checkpoints, changes, failures, agent actions) so users can ask questions about what happened during their AI-assisted coding session. Chat responses are grounded in actual session evidence rather than general knowledge.
Unique: Provides a chat interface pre-loaded with full session context (checkpoints, changes, failures) so responses are grounded in actual session evidence — most chat interfaces lack session-specific context.
vs alternatives: Unlike generic ChatGPT or Copilot chat, Unfold AI's chat knows your full session history and can answer questions about what your agent did, making it more useful for session-specific debugging.
Monitors changes from multiple AI agents (Cursor, GitHub Copilot, Claude Code, Codex, Continue, Codeium) simultaneously and surfaces all failures, changes, and risk signals in a unified dashboard within VS Code. Tracks which agent made which change and correlates failures to specific agent actions across the session.
Unique: Provides unified monitoring and attribution for multiple AI agents (Cursor, Copilot, Claude Code, Codex, Continue, Codeium) in a single VS Code dashboard — most agents operate in isolation without cross-agent visibility.
vs alternatives: Unlike individual agent error handling, Unfold AI provides a unified view of all agent activity and failures, making it easier to manage multi-agent workflows and identify which agent caused issues.

Cursor Capabilities
Cursor integrates AI capabilities directly into the IDE to facilitate real-time pair programming. It leverages a collaborative editing model that allows multiple users to interact with the code simultaneously while receiving AI-generated suggestions and insights. This is distinct because it combines AI assistance with live collaboration features, enabling seamless interaction between developers and the AI.
Unique: Cursor's architecture allows for real-time AI interaction within a collaborative environment, unlike traditional IDEs that separate coding and AI assistance.
vs alternatives: More integrated than tools like GitHub Copilot, as it supports live collaboration directly in the IDE.
Cursor provides contextual code suggestions based on the current file and project context. It analyzes the code structure and dependencies to generate relevant snippets and completions, using a deep learning model trained on a vast codebase. This capability is distinct because it adapts suggestions based on the entire project context rather than isolated files.
Unique: Utilizes a project-wide context analysis to provide suggestions, unlike other tools that focus only on the current line or file.
vs alternatives: More context-aware than traditional code completion tools, which often lack project-level awareness.
Cursor offers integrated debugging assistance by analyzing code execution paths and suggesting potential fixes for errors. It employs static analysis and runtime monitoring to identify issues and provide actionable insights. This capability is unique as it combines real-time debugging with AI-driven suggestions, allowing developers to resolve issues more efficiently.
Unique: Combines real-time error monitoring with AI suggestions, unlike traditional debuggers that require manual analysis.
vs alternatives: More proactive than standard IDE debuggers, which typically provide limited feedback.
Cursor facilitates collaborative documentation generation by allowing developers to create and edit documentation alongside their code. It uses AI to suggest documentation content based on code comments and structure, enabling a seamless integration of documentation into the development workflow. This capability is unique because it encourages documentation as part of the coding process rather than as an afterthought.
Unique: Integrates documentation generation directly into the coding workflow, unlike traditional tools that separate documentation from coding.
vs alternatives: More integrated than standalone documentation tools, which often require context switching.
Cursor enables real-time code review by allowing team members to comment and suggest changes directly within the IDE. It leverages AI to highlight potential issues and suggest improvements based on best practices. This capability is distinct because it combines live feedback with AI insights, fostering a more interactive review process.
Unique: Combines live code review with AI suggestions, unlike traditional code review tools that operate asynchronously.
vs alternatives: More interactive than standard code review tools, which often lack real-time collaboration features.
